0.9.5 missing Vendor folder & PHPMailer not working #468
Comments
Hello kykpeng,
You seem to be pointing to two different concerns, as such:
1. The missing of <vendor> folder.
2. Email related error message being notified.
Issue #1:
1.a - Resolution is not copying over another app version’s <vendor> folder over.
1.b – You need to run Composer install command to download and retrieve the right modules for the application’s correct version.
Issue #2:
2.a – Certainly copying of another <vendor> folder from another version of the app will not help.
2.b – 1st ensure you run the Composer install command to download and retrieve the right modules’ versions for the application to work as expected.
If issue persists, please feel free to follow-up with the followings:
* Detailed steps you’ve taken for us to reproduce the error.
* Detailed error message (or server log file preferably).

Expected behavior and actual behavior.
0.9.5 repositories are missing ./vendor folder. It works after simply taking the ./vendor folder from 0.9.4. However, the PHPMailer function outputs errors and cannot send email via any of the ... mail(), sendmail, or SMTP options
Steps to reproduce the problem.
download and install a fresh copy of 0.9.5 on a PHP7.2 LAMP machine
What version of opencats are you running?
0.9.5
Release or downloaded from Git?
Downloaded
WAMP or LAMP?
LAMP
What version of PHP and MySQL are you running
PHP 7.2.4, MySQL 14
